3. COST-EFFECTIVENESS OF DAYE SMART ENERGY STORAGE
Cost-efficiency is another remarkable aspect of Daye Smart Energy Storage. At first glance, the initial investment may appear substantial; however, the long-term savings outweigh the upfront costs. The system significantly reduces electricity bills by enabling users to shift energy consumption to off-peak hours, when rates are generally lower. By leveraging stored energy during periods of high demand, users can dodge peak pricing, leading to substantial savings over time.
Moreover, many governmental incentives exist for adopting renewable energy solutions, including tax rebates and grants, which can further reduce the financial burden. By integrating Daye’s systems, users may qualify for these programs, effectively lowering the investment cost and enhancing overall financial viability.
